I have 4 R550 APs with unleashed version and I have 2 SSID Office and Guest. All the APs are connected to ICX 7150 Access switch and then to ICX 7550 L3 switch and then to gateway Fortinet Firewall.
SSID Office and Guest are mapped to VLAN 102 and 140 respectively, I have created trunk between AP and Switch and from access to L3 switch, I can ping to VLAN 102 and 140 gateway from my L2 switch, but I am getting IP in VLAN 1 management range. What went wrong? I can also ping DHCP server from my L2 switch.

I hope you have configured the correct VLAN on each WLAN under advanced setting, if not, please verify.
In RUCKUS, default VLAN 1 is an untagged VLAN (and VLAN1 cannot be tagged) and as soon as you change it from 1 to any other VLAN, it becomes a tagged VLAN.
